Ingredients and Preparation00:01:12

The recipe starts with 1kg of ground pork mixed with dark brown sugar, a generous amount of garlic, oyster sauce, annatto powder for color, black pepper, iodized salt, flour as a binder, and a touch of ketchup.

Mixing and Shaping00:03:49

Mix the ingredients thoroughly until the meat mixture reaches a paste-like consistency. Use an ice cream scooper for uniform sizing and parchment paper to roll and shape the sausages.

Cooking the Longganisa00:07:51

Pan-fry the sausages over low heat using a covered pan to ensure they cook thoroughly on the inside. Covering the pan uses steam to cook the meat without burning the sugar-heavy exterior.

Serving Suggestions00:10:23

The finished Longganisa is best served with garlic fried rice and fried eggs, paired with a dipping sauce of vinegar, garlic, and chili for a complete, classic breakfast.
